What Are Procedures?

Procedures are the core workflow feature of Altoura Frontline. They represent digitized, step-by-step work instructions that guide field workers through tasks using augmented reality on a head-mounted display. Each procedure consists of:
  • Tasks: High-level groupings of related work (e.g., “Prepare Equipment”, “Replace Filter”).
  • Steps: Individual actions within a task that the worker follows sequentially.
  • 3D Models & Media: Visual aids including 3D models, images, and videos anchored in the worker’s physical environment.
  • Anchor Gems: Spatial markers that position procedure content in the correct physical location.

Two Modes

Altoura Frontline Procedures operate in two distinct modes:

Author Mode

Author Mode is for content creators who build and configure procedures. In this mode, you can:
  • Create and organize tasks and steps
  • Place and position 3D models in the physical space
  • Set anchor gems for spatial alignment
  • Configure choice steps and completion criteria
  • Preview how procedures will appear to operators

Operator Mode

Operator Mode is for field workers who execute procedures. In this mode, you can:
  • Browse and select available procedures
  • Follow step-by-step guidance with AR overlays
  • View 3D models, media, and annotations anchored in your environment
  • Navigate through tasks using the procedure panel
  • Complete steps and mark tasks as done
